In this episode of Apple Pie Playground, host Valerie explores the biblical concept of "girding one's loins" through the lens of quantum mechanics and spiritual sovereignty. The discussion provides a roadmap for maintaining energetic alignment and finding "right action" even when faced with life's most difficult "plumbing problems" and external chaos.

The Foundation of Spiritual Sovereignty

The core of the discussion centers on a quote attributed to Christ: "Gird your loins with great strength so that the robbers will not find a way to get to you." Historically, "girding" referred to tucking in one's garments to prepare for a heavy lift or a battle. In a spiritual context, this represents the protection of our "eternal spark" and sovereign spirit. When the external world—corrupted societies, loss of property, or personal tragedy—takes everything else away, our energetic practices and internal alignment are the only tools left to enforce the liberties of our domain.

Alignment as a Quantum Practice

Alignment is not merely a feeling but a deliberate practice of coherence within the quantum field. Valerie defines "beingness" as motion—a micro-level vibration that never truly stops. To align is to synchronize this motion with the "Christ consciousness" or the unified field surrounding us. This requires identifying the "robbers"—which are often forms of self-sabotage like fear, distraction, and unpracticed behaviors—that steal our peace and tether to source energy. By controlling the energy we project, we manage the "echo" or the ripples that the quantum field returns to us.

Mastery through Ease and Non-Resistance

A significant hurdle to alignment is the tendency to "force" outcomes or mold oneself into inauthentic identities to meet external expectations. True mastery, as echoed in Taoist philosophy, is finding tranquility in chaos. When we are aligned, "right action" arises effortlessly; if a path feels like constant resistance, it is often a sign of misalignment. Stability is built not through just planning or reading, but through the active engagement of intentions in the present moment, supported by grace and abundant self-forgiveness.
